Verizon Workers Overwhelmingly Ratify New Contracts

Today, CWA announced that the roughly 40,000 union members along the East Coast who had been on strike for 49 days have ratified new contracts. CWA members in the New York-New England region (CWA District 1) and the mid-Atlantic (CWA District 2-13) and in New Jersey overwhelmingly ratified four-year contracts.

Members of IBEW Locals 827 (mid-Atlantic) and 2213, New York, and T6 in New England also overwhelmingly ratified the contracts

Verizon Wireless workers in Brooklyn and in Everett, MA also overwhelmingly approved their first-ever contract. The contract includes higher wages, a grievance and arbitration procedure, and restrictions on subcontracting.
